Message-ID: <963@airgun.wg.waii.com> Date: 29 May 91 17:38:01 GMT References: <91146.235414CALT@SLACVM.SLAC.STANFORD.EDU> <8012@awdprime.UUCP> Organization: Western Geophysical, A Division of Western Atlas International, Houston, TX Lines: 29 In article <8012@awdprime.UUCP>, jaime@excalibur.austin.ibm.com writes: > In article <91146.235414CALT@SLACVM.SLAC.STANFORD.EDU>, > CALT@SLACVM.SLAC.STANFORD.EDU writes: > > > > I have an RS/6000 320 running AIX 3.1.5. I made an image backup via > > SMIT startup with the system backup option. Can I install this image > > onto an RS/6000 530? > > This should work without any problems at all. The use of the system > image tape from smit should transport across all machine types. > > Jaime Vazquez Voice: 512-838-4829 or t/l 678-4829 > AIX Technical Support Fax: 512-838-4851 or t/l 678-4851 The reverse of making 530 tapes to take to the 320 did not work for us. Something about the internal hard disk controller on the 320. Code for that driver was not supplied with 530 build tapes. Or at least that was the story were were told. :-) We had to re-install on the 320 from system tapes sent for that machine from Austin (or where ever they make install tapes). -- Mark Whetzel My comments are my own, not my company's.
